ZIP code 52550 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Delta, Keokuk County, Iowa, home to just 585 residents across 100.9 square miles, a density of 6 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 52550 reports a modest median household income of $57,745 (25% below the average Iowa ZIP), while per-capita income is $30,972. The poverty rate is 9.1%, with unemployment at 5.3%; those measures add context to the income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$110,200 (37% below the average Iowa ZIP), and median rent is $1,038; owner occupancy is 88.3%.
